Brazil to China – which carrier in biz class?

Brazil to China – which carrier in biz class?

  1. Jim R New Member

    Need to book a RT biz class journey GRU PEK in a few weeks. I am AA EXP and want to stay in OW if possible and also want to try one of the Gulf carriers for the first time. QR flies the route through Doha, but looks like they use a 777-300 and 777-200 and the schedule is pretty awful (4:15 am departure, for example). My question is, is it worth going QR given the aircraft — would I get the full experience? — or is it better to save a few (thousand!) dollars and go with a tried and true but boring TAM / BA routing through Europe, or AA through the US? What would you do?

    Thanks if you can offer any perspective or wisdom.
